TaylorMade M3

Our Review:

Tiny changes equal big benefits—like the screw on the adjustable hosel that weighs a third less than it did on last year's M1. This provides more room to position the center of gravity forward, and it frees up room to make the slot in the sole wider for better performance on strikes that occur low on the clubface. The 30-gram sliding weight also makes it simple to dial in a draw or fade.

Player Comments
Low-Handicapper
It had a firm sound to it. There's no vibration; it just rockets. Workability was good.
Mid-Handicapper
This club will hide a multitude of sins in your golf swing. Smooth, powerful, great distance and easy to turn over.
High-Handicapper
The adjustability was great for dialing this in for me. I got a lot of power from it and plenty of distance.
